Output 6ecfbd13534149e35df33e68c0df2b2d9eaf66b01c73e832d9940468e4106106: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e91a287aad9f46f43d5420ebac2ac4446d8366 OP_EQUAL
address
3CXkuQLV1KmiQHV8mmWT92pEz1xohnRN35
transaction
6ecfbd13534149e35df33e68c0df2b2d9eaf66b01c73e832d9940468e4106106
confirmations
161335
spent
true